About to hire a car in Gladesville? Here are a few top tips to keep in mind.
Before hitting the road in Sydney, familiarise yourself with Australian road rules and regulations. Remember that Australians drive on the left-hand side of the road, seatbelts must be worn at all times and pay attention to speed limits and other road signs to ensure a safe and enjoyable driving experience.
If you're driving in regional areas, be aware that animals and wildlife can wander onto the roads. Be sure to drive to the speed limit and do not swerve suddenly, as this can cause cars to roll off the road. Plus, full-license drivers in NSW have a legal BAC (Blood Alcohol Concentration) limit of under 0.05.
One of the busiest roads drivers will need to navigate in Gladesville is Victoria Road. This is one of the longest stretches of roads in Sydney, connecting Parramatta with Rozelle.
Plus, recent changes to the Rozelle interchange have increased congestion with travel time for CBD-bound traffic, with Victoria Road and Gladesville Bridge proving peak congestion spots. Our tip? Try to avoid driving along these peak roads on weekdays from 6 am to 10 am and between 4 pm to 7 pm.
While there are no toll roads directly in Gladesville, you'll likely drive along toll roads and tunnels if you plan to venture across greater Sydney (such as the WestConnex M4, Rozelle Interchange and Harbour Tunnel). Make sure your hire car is fitted with an e-tag prior to departure for a smooth driving experience along toll roads.
There are many on-street and off-street parking options across Gladesville. For secure off-street parking, head to the John Wilson Car Park (Pittwater Road), Peel Park Carpark (81 Morrison Road) and Riverglade Reserve Parking (38 Manning Road).

To book a car on Turo in Gladesville, you must create a Turo account, be 21 years old or older, have a valid driver’s licence, and get approved to drive on Turo. When you’re booking your first trip, you’ll go through a quick approval process by entering your driver’s licence and some other information. In most cases, you’ll get approved immediately, and you’ll be set for every future road trip, business trip, and family holiday!
No, you don’t need personal insurance coverage to rent a car on Turo.
When booking a car in Australia, you’ll choose between the Premier (if available), Standard, and Minimum protection plans. Each plan includes varying limits on financial responsibility for damage to a host’s vehicle. All trips include up to $20,000,000 (per event) in legal liability protection. Legal liability protection protects against damage to other people’s property and death or bodily injury (where the legal liability is not covered or capable of being covered by any statutory or compulsory scheme) as a result of an accident involving the vehicle. Some hosts offer unlimited kilometre car rental; others set a daily distance limit. On the vehicle pages, you’ll see the total miles or kilometres you’re allowed to drive under the heading “Distance included.” You can find cars offering unlimited mileage with every trip by using the “Unlimited distance” filter.
You can cancel and get a full refund up to 24 hours before your trip starts, unless you opt to receive a non-refundable trip discount when you book. If you book a trip with less than 24 hours’ notice, you have one hour after booking to cancel free of charge. If you cancel after the free cancellation period ends, you will be charged a cancellation fee.

No. Unlike rental car companies, Turo is a peer-to-peer car sharing marketplace where you can book directly from trusted local car owners in the US, UK, Canada, and Australia. Turo does not own any vehicles — Turo hosts share their own personal cars and set their own prices, discounts, vehicle availability, and delivery options.
There is no fee or additional charge for adding a driver to your trip on Turo. Only the guest who booked the trip can request to add drivers; Turo hosts cannot do it for you. We encourage you to request to add any additional drivers before your trip starts, though guests in the US, Canada, and Australia can request to add a driver while a trip is in progress.
To speed up the process, have your additional driver create a Turo account and get approved to drive before you request to add them. All drivers must have a valid driver’s licence and meet the age requirements for the car you’ve booked. You can request to add drivers via the “Trips” tab in the Turo app without additional driver charges or extra costs.

No, you can't hire a car on your Ps in Gladesville. To hire a car on Turo, you must have a valid full licence - no provisional or conditional licences are accepted.
The minimum age to rent a car in Gladesville on Turo is 21 years of age, with all drivers under 25 years old being subjected to an extra cost of $15/day (a.k.a the Young Driver Surcharge). Plus, if you're looking to hire certain vehicle classes, you must be 25 or older to book a Deluxe Class vehicle, and 30 or older to book a Super Deluxe Class vehicle.
